VizieR Online Data Catalog: Variability in protoplanetary nebulae. VII. 5 LCs (Hrivnak+, 2020)
Abstract
Most of the observations were carried out at the Valparaiso University Observatory (VUO) with the 0.4m telescope and SBIG 6303 CCD camera. Observations began in 2008 and were carried out through 2017 or 2018, depending upon the object. These were complemented by observations made with two telescopes operated by the Southeastern Association for Research in Astronomy (SARA). They are the 0.9m at Kitt Peak National Observatory (SARA-KP) and the 0.6m Lowell telescope at Cerro-Tololo Interamerican Observatory (SARA-CT). The SARA observations began in 2009 or 2010 and continued through 2016 or 2018, depending upon the object. Standard Johnson V and Cousins RC filters were used with each of the telescope-detector systems.
